Just wanted to share that shyoukos offered a solution to get kernel 5.9 for el7 worked updated the kernel to 5.9.12 current newest ML:

uname -r
5.9.12-1.el7.elrepo.x86_64

Tried the first time got this error:

virt-customize: error: libguestfs error: could not create appliance through 
libvirt.

Try running qemu directly without libvirt using this environment variable:
export LIBGUESTFS_BACKEND=direct

Original error from libvirt: unsupported configuration: Domain requires 
KVM, but it is not available. Check that virtualization is enabled in the 
host BIOS, and host configuration is setup to load the kvm modules. 
[code=67 int1=-1]

If reporting bugs, run virt-customize with debugging enabled and include 
the complete output:

  virt-customize -v -x [...]

Run command as told in error:

#export LIBGUESTFS_BACKEND=direct

Then try again:

#virt-customize -a centos-8.qcow2 --install epel-release

[   0.0] Examining the guest ...
[  41.6] Setting a random seed
[  42.5] Setting the machine ID in /etc/machine-id
[  42.5] Installing packages: epel-release
[ 155.8] Finishing off
